Lao Folks’s Democratic Republic (Lao PDR) is extremely prone to local weather change and pure hazards, notably to flood and drought situations which significantly have an effect on the nation’s agricultural manufacturing. Though regularly declining when it comes to its contribution to GDP lately, agriculture continues to play a significant position in Lao PDR’s economic system. Kangphosay village, situated in Savannakhet Province, and its surrounding agricultural lands are situated alongside the financial institution of a river, an space which is susceptible to flooding. Since 1992, villagers have skilled 4 main floods, the newest in 2015 when 106 hectares of agricultural land had been flooded, damaging multiple third of cropped land. 4 years earlier, in 2011, the village misplaced all its crops throughout a significant flood that endured for 3 months. Nearly 400 hectares of farm land is doubtlessly susceptible to flood harm in any given 12 months, and the water degree can stay persistently excessive for months at a time. FAO and the European Union partnered with the Ministry of Agriculture and Forestry and Laotian Province authorities to offer catastrophe threat discount and administration (DRRM) coaching in agriculture in Kangphosay village, with the goal of accelerating farmers’ resilience to disasters and broadening livelihood variety.

Lao PDR may be very susceptible to pure disasters, together with excessive climate occasions which have been growing in frequency and depth. Nearly all of the nation’s farming techniques are prone to flooding, drought and the late onset of the wet seasons. With a excessive dependency on conventional agricultural techniques and a predominance of smallholder farms, the impacts of such pure disasters might be all of the extra devastating.

Good Observe Operations
FAO’s DRRM coaching has supported smallholder farmers in Kangphosay village not solely in adopting Good Observe Operations (GPOs) designed to stop flood harm, but additionally in adapting efficiently their method to fish tradition. Malaythip Viengmany, a smallholder farmer and beneficiary from Kangphosay village whose livelihood primarily depends on fish farming, is now sharing her data with others, and the neighborhood as a complete can be diversifying livestock.

“Earlier when the floods got here, there was no solution to keep away from the loss. One of many prevention choices provided by the undertaking, which we’ve adopted, is to position a excessive internet fence across the fish pond so that in durations of flooding the fish weren’t swept away. Aside from this, the undertaking additionally launched some new strategies for elevating fish”, defined Malaythip.  “Due to the help from FAO undertaking we’re in a position to elevate extra fish and decrease the harm from the floods.” At the moment, Malaythip and her household not solely have ample fish for their very own consumption, however they’re additionally in a position to complement their earnings by promoting the manufacturing surplus.

As a FAO undertaking village, Kangphosay has ten taking part households within the GPO programme, comprising flood tolerant rice, fish cultures, and natural fertilizer/soil enchancment. Farmers have obtained soil enchancment coaching to provide natural fertilizer and, in consequence, have elevated their total agricultural manufacturing. Along with boosting their very own livelihoods, they’ve shared these strategies with different farmers to unfold the follow all through the neighborhood. Whereas at present applied GPOs provide important alternatives to cut back vulnerability in goal areas, their selective implementation leaves nice room for growth.

Resilient livelihood alternatives for girls
Kangphosay villagers have pursued a spread of actions to broaden their livelihood variety, from rising a number of sorts of crops to elevating various kinds of livestock and creating supplemental incomes. Extra actions, farm and enterprise –centered, goal to restrict the impacts of disasters, specifically the exploration of resilient livelihood alternatives for girls.

Historically, ladies have had a robust agricultural position in Lao PDR communities, and that position must be enhanced. Elevated inclusion of ladies in agricultural choice making and coaching actions, as demonstrated by the success of the GPO programme, will increase the effectiveness of the neighborhood’s agricultural system as a complete.

District Agricultural Officers periodically test in with communities to offer extra help and assets, taken up by the residents and native leaders. In help of this purpose, DRRM plans have confirmed most profitable when native stakeholders take possession of the processes and set up periodic conferences to supervise the implementation of actions.

Mainstreaming DRRM into agricultural planning
The Ministry of Agriculture and Forestry (MAF) has taken vital steps to higher deal with and mainstream DRRM into agricultural planning. With the help of FAO, they’ve developed a sector-specific Plan of Motion (PoA) for DRRM in agriculture to boost consciousness, strengthen sectoral capabilities and promote a proactive method to DRRM.

With FAO’s help, the Authorities has been growing the resilience of agricultural communities to disasters, and in 2014 a Plan of Motion for Catastrophe Danger Discount Administration in Agriculture was produced. The Group is at present supporting implementation of the Plan by creating tips for planners and technical officers, discipline testing and validating good follow choices. Help can be enabling the Authorities to offer speedy and coordinated cross-sectoral responses to poultry illness epidemics – together with the detection and stamping out of a number of outbreaks of Extremely Pathogenic Avian Influenza (HPAI).
